2015-10-14 105 views
0

我需要測試使用Apache Phoenix(基於HBase的SQL層)作爲數據源的DAO層(在Spring JDBC中編寫)。Apache Phoenix DAO測試

我對測試數據庫沒有太多經驗。我做了一些研究,我知道最常見的問題是使用InMemory數據庫,但在這種特殊情況下,我不能使用InMemory數據庫,因爲Phoenix在SQL方言中有一些差異。 所以我的問題是在這種情況下編寫集成測試的最佳方法是什麼。

回答

0

您可以參考一個IT測試案例org.apache.phoenix.end2end.QueryIT在apache phoenix代碼中編寫自己的